When the temperature drops to 3oc (when frost alert flashes) the handbook symbol pops up.
Any ideas. I already have a new hevac unit ambient air sensor and a new heater matrix.

Paul
 
Could be the distribution flap sticking in the heater box,when you start up from cold the flaps to the limit of travel in each direction.If the Hevac Ecu does not see full movement on all three blend motors it flags a fault.
The distribution flaps seem to be tight in the box,when they warm up a bit they free off enough to work.Can be a bit of a bu--er to sort out.
You really need to stick it on testbook to find out exactly what is going on.Hevac on LP RR's is the fussiest system on the car and can be a real pain to sort out,but at least the fault codes usually relate fairly closely to whats going on.(Unlike EAS)
